What is DeepSeek V3?
DeepSeek V3 is an advanced AI model developed to improve upon its predecessors in terms of speed, accuracy, and overall performance. It's designed to handle a wide range of tasks, from code review and data analysis to complex problem-solving.
One of the key goals behind DeepSeek V3 was to make AI more accessible and practical for everyday use. The developers aimed to create a model that could be easily integrated into various workflows and applications, regardless of the user's technical expertise.
DeepSeek V3 leverages state-of-the-art neural network architectures and advanced training techniques to achieve its impressive capabilities. According to the DeepSeek official documentation, it is fine-tuned for specific tasks, allowing it to deliver optimized results in various domains.

DeepSeek V3 Architecture
Understanding the architecture of DeepSeek V3 can give you insights into why it performs so well. The model is built on a foundation of state-of-the-art neural networks and utilizes advanced techniques to optimize performance.
The core components include:
- Transformer Networks: These networks are the backbone of DeepSeek V3, enabling it to process and understand complex data patterns.
- Attention Mechanisms: Attention mechanisms allow the model to focus on the most relevant parts of the input data, improving accuracy and efficiency.
- Scalable Design: DeepSeek V3 is designed to be scalable, allowing it to handle large datasets and complex tasks without sacrificing performance.
